8,696,542 (eight million six hundred ninety-six thousand five hundred forty-two) is an even 7-digit number. It is a composite number with 4 divisors, and factors as 2 × 4,348,271. Written other ways, in hexadecimal, 0x84B2DE.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 8696542, here are decompositions:

  • 11 + 8696531 = 8696542
  • 59 + 8696483 = 8696542
  • 83 + 8696459 = 8696542
  • 131 + 8696411 = 8696542
  • 233 + 8696309 = 8696542
  • 269 + 8696273 = 8696542
  • 293 + 8696249 = 8696542
  • 353 + 8696189 = 8696542

Showing the first eight; more decompositions exist.
